Vulnerability from github – Published: 2026-07-24 22:26 – Updated: 2026-08-12 21:12Summary
blaze-server can merge HTTP/1.1 chunked-body trailer fields into Request.headers. Because trailer fields are attacker-controlled, an unauthenticated remote client can inject arbitrary header names/values (e.g. X-Forwarded-For, internal-auth headers) that a fronting proxy sanitized from the request-header section, bypassing header-based trust decisions in the application.
### Impact
Any http4s application using BlazeServerBuilder over HTTP/1.1 whose routes or middleware trust proxy-set headers (e.g., X-Forwarded-For, X-Real-IP, X-Forwarded-Host, org-internal auth headers) is affected. Where a fronting proxy strips/normalizes those headers but forwards chunked bodies with trailers intact, an attacker can spoof client IP for allow-lists/rate-limits/audit, forge the https scheme, or inject internal-auth headers. A promoted Connection: close trailer is also honored, allowing attacker-controlled termination of pooled backend connections.
### Workarounds Deploy behind a proxy that removes trailer fields (or rejects requests that use trailers) before forwarding; until patched, avoid trust decisions based on headers that a proxy is relied upon to sanitize.
